BARCLAYS bank in Northwich high street has been evacuated this morning due to a suspected electrical fire.
Firefighters were called to the scene shortly before 9am after smoke was seen coming from an electrical box.
Customers were evacuated as a precautionary measure but staff remained in the bank.
A spokesman for Cheshire Fire and Rescue Service said: “We received a call at 8.53am after smoke was seen coming from an electrical box.
“Firefighters are still in the process of investigating though it does not appear as though any fires have had to be put out.
“The building was evacuated as a precautionary measure.”
